Views underneath the chassis of a Ford truck, showing torque tube and radius rods, showing attachment to front axle, and how rear springs are devoted entirely to absorbing road shocks. Cutaway animated view of the Ford 3/4 type floating rear axle, with various gears in motion. Cutaway internal views of Double roller-type rear wheel bearings are shown and external view with double wheels.Front tranverse springs are shown. New semi-elliptic rear springs are shown. Brake cables and drum-type brakes are demonstrated.
A 1932 model Ford Stake bed truck drives up to the camera and stops. Several views of the truck. ( A playground with children at play is seen in background.) View of interior through right-hand door, as driver enters at left door and settles himself on seat. He sets manual choke and throttle, steps on foot accelerator pedal, checks gears in neutral and hand brake off. Driver turns steering wheel several turns to left. View shifts to cutaway of steering mechanism showing its action. Truck drives up to a loading dock, backs into position, and then drives away. Scene shifts to a busy city street, where the truck is seen in traffic. It waits with other vehicles as pedestrians cross with the light, and then proceeds. The truck pulls into a Ford Benzol station where operator refuels it.
New Ford trucks moving on assembly line in factory. Several drive out of the factory without final rear bodies. A truck equipped with stake bed sitting at a farm. views of the truck bed, and removable stake sides and back. Various configurations shown. Views of small dump truck with dual rear wheels sitting outside a factory. Demonstration of dumping with truck bed elevated by hydraulic cylinder.Another truck shown with open sides, covered roof, and bench seats along both sides of the truck body. A similar truck covered with tarpaulin cover. A pickup truck with tailgate. A bus built on a Ford truck chassis. Views of the bus, including demonstration of driver opening its door, and views of interior and seats. Examples of several different Ford bus body styles and several different truck body styles, including a wrecker-tow truck.
Documentary titled 'Introduction to the P-39'. Trainee pilots look at a Bell P-39 Aircobra pursuit aircraft in flight. It lands on an airstrip. The pilot emerges from the cockpit. The pilot talks to new P-39 pilots about the specification and capabilities of the P-39. Guns on the nose and wings of the plane. P-39 in flight. The guns triggered and fired. (World War II period).
A Bell P-39 Airacobra pursuit aircraft in flight. Pilot debriefs the trainee pilots about the maneuverability of the P-39. A trainee Pilot prepares to enter a P-39 taxi on airstrip. Parachute straps. Cockpit view of the P-39. Aircraft's rudder, pedals, elevators, brakes, shoulder straps, emergency release handle, radio control, transmitter, and receiver check before take off. Landing gear switch, guns switches and propeller controls also check.
Propeller of a Bell P-39 Airacobra pursuit aircraft. Cockpit view of a P-39. Propeller and fuel controls operate. Animation shows the flow of fuel inside a P-39 aircraft. Pictorial view of the P-39's reserve fuel tank. A belly fuel tank attach beneath the P-39's fuselage.
